Fun Ford Weekend Buckeye Nationals 2003

July 11, 2003 //  by Horsepower & Heels

Fun Ford Weekend Buckeye Nationals 2003 Norwalk, Ohio

After pulling into a muddy Norwalk racetrack Friday afternoon, Horsepower & Heels driver Erica Ortiz unloads the car to find a leaky head gasket.   The team had just replaced heads before the haul and the new sealant didn’t adhere properly.    Although she missed Round 1 qualifying, Erica had the car back to running late that night.

In the morning, Ortiz lined up for 2nd round qualifying. But after violent tire shake the first 660 ft, the best she could muster was a 10.03 @ 158 mph. She headed back to the trailer to ponder how to make the car hook, and improved in the 3rd round to qualify in the #3 spot with a 9.325 @ 159.55 mph.

In Eliminations, Erica took the win with a 9.23 @ 160.30 mph against Brad Hevwagen. But in the second round, Erica lost the hook and the round against Randy Haywood, after a close pair of 9.20’s from both.

Fun Ford Weekend Old Dominion Nationals 2003

June 27, 2003 //  by Horsepower & Heels

After a disappointing finish in the previous race in Gainesville, the Horsepower & Heels Racing team had only 2 weeks to put together an entire new engine program for the Fun Ford Weekend Old Dominion Nationals event in Richmond, VA.

New Engine Combo

Friday’s test pass was the first time the new motor had ever been run. The maiden voyage first qualifying run on Friday yielded a 9.38 @ 158mph E.T., with driver Erica Ortiz peddling hard the bottom end of the track to maintain traction. This put Erica in the #4 spot for Saturday’s “Race within a Race” shootout event.    The race within a race, sponsored by Innovative Turbo Systems matched the top 8 qualifiers from Friday’s qualifying in a shoot out ladder during Saturday’s qualifications.

Race within a Race Drag Radial Shootout

Saturday morning, Erica was paired 1st round against rival racer Christina Eldert’s new coupe in a women’s racing battle. After all was said and done, Erica advanced to the 2nd round as the top female with a win on the tree and at the light.   But in the 2nd round, Erica spun hard off the line again and was defeated by Norris McKay, who went on to win the shootout event and the Innovative Turbo prize money.

Eliminations

With a final qualifying effort of 9.21 @ 158, Erica was #4 on Sunday’s ladder for eliminations. Her first round match up paired her with Alex Vretto. Unfortunately, Erica had problems on the line spooling up and lost on a hole shot, running a quicker 9.24 to Alex’s 9.44.

Fun Ford Weekend Peach State Nationals 03

April 7, 2003 //  by Horsepower & Heels

Fun Ford Weekend Peach State Nationals

April 2003- Commerce, GA

This race would be the finish to the previous rain-delayed FFW Spring Break Shootout event in Orlando,

Runner up, FFW Spring Break Shootout 2003

After qualifying #3 with a 9.003 @ 159mph, Erica makes history as the first female in a final round in the drag radial class for Orlando’s rain-delayed final against Chris Little. The car lost traction, and Erica runners-up with a 9.90 @ 159mph.

First woman in the 8’s in drag radial

Entering Atlanta eliminations on Sunday, Erica gets a lucky break with several competition bye runs. She ran the fastest lap of round 1 with an 8.90 @ 163 mph and becomes the first female in the 8’s on a drag radial!

Runner-up, FFW Peach State Nationals 2003

Again, she reaches the Atlanta finals to face Big Daddy in an all-Innovative turbo final round. Despite a hole shot by Erica, the car again lost traction, and she could not catch him, running a 9.40 @ 153mph.

Fun Ford Weekend Spring Break Shootout 2003

March 1, 2003 //  by Horsepower & Heels

The Fun Ford Weekend Spring Break Shootout event for the 2003 season was held at the Orlando Speed World Dragway.    This is the Fun Ford season opening event, and for Erica Ortiz, it is a hometown event held right in the Horsepower & Heels backyard.

Erica Ortiz entered her turbocharged Mustang in the Drag Radial class for the event.   But weather made the weekend a soggy one.   Erica would be able to get in a few good runs, advancing to Round 2 of eliminations after defeating Frank Provenza in Round 1.   Unfortunately, the event would be postponed due to rain delay and would be continued at the next race the Peach State Nationals in Commerce, GA.
